Elements in the Periodic Table can have vastly different physical properties based on their position in the table. For instance, metals like sodium (Na) are typically malleable, conductive, and have high melting points, while nonmetals like oxygen (O) are gaseous at room temperature, brittle, and poor conductors. Additionally, noble gases like neon (Ne) are colorless, odorless, and inert, contrasting sharply with the highly reactive properties of alkali metals like potassium (K). These differences arise from variations in atomic structure, bonding, and electron configurations.

When elements are arranged in order of increasing atomic number there is a periodic repetition of their chemical and physical properties is a statement of the?

This statement is a simplified explanation of the periodic law, which states that the properties of elements are periodic functions of their atomic numbers. This periodicity is observed in the arrangement of elements in the periodic table, where elements with similar properties appear in the same column (group) due to their similar electron configurations.
